Introduction to Jade
Introduction to Jade is designed to teach the basic gemmology and formation of the different jades. We will also cover treatments and the many jade imitations and how to identify these. Jade and instruments are provided for a hands-on experience. You can also bring along some of your own jade for testing & identification.

COURSE OUTLINE
- What is Jade
- What are the different types of Jade
- How to identify if you have Jade
- How to identify if your Jade has been treated
- How to identify the many imitations of Jade
